On x86_32, non-standard logical apicid mapping can be used by different NUMA setups. The mapping can be determined while bringing up each CPU after apic->init_apic_ldr(). The logical apicid is then used to deliver IPIs and determine NUMA configuration.
Unfortunately, initializing at SMP bring up is too late for percpu setup making static percpu variables setup w/o considering NUMA. This also is different from how x86_64 is configured making the code difficult to follow and maintain.
Use the unused apic->cpu_to_logical_apicid() to find out the logical apic id mapping before SMP bring up. The callback is called once during get_smp_config() and the output is recorded in x86_cpu_to_logical_apicid. apic implementation is free to return BAD_APICID from the callback if it can't be determined at the time. The early mapping is later verified and reinitialized during SMP bring up.
A stub implementation for apic->cpu_to_logical_apicid() is added for each non-standard apic.
